Lyophilizers, also known as freeze dryers, are essential tools in many industries, including pharmaceuticals, food processing, and research laboratories. These machines are used to remove moisture from various materials while preserving their integrity and extending their shelf life. When considering purchasing a lyophilizer, one of the key factors to take into account is the price. The cost of a lyophilizer can vary widely depending on several factors, so it is crucial to understand what influences the price and how to choose the right machine for your needs.
One of the most significant factors that affect the price of a lyophilizer is its size and capacity. Lyophilizers come in a range of sizes, from small benchtop units suitable for research laboratories to large-scale industrial machines used in pharmaceutical production. The larger the capacity of the lyophilizer, the higher the price is likely to be. It is essential to consider the volume of material you need to process and choose a lyophilizer with a capacity that meets your requirements without overspending on a larger machine.
Another factor that influences the price of a lyophilizer is its features and capabilities. Some lyophilizers come with advanced features such as programmable cycles, data logging, vacuum control, and shelf heating. These additional features can increase the price of the lyophilizer but may be essential for specific applications or to achieve the desired drying results. When comparing lyophilizer prices, it is essential to consider whether the machine’s features are necessary for your needs or if you can opt for a simpler, more cost-effective model.
The type of lyophilizer also plays a significant role in determining its price. There are two main types of lyophilizers: shelf freeze dryers and rotary freeze dryers. Shelf freeze dryers are more common and typically cost less than rotary freeze dryers, which are larger and more complex machines. The choice between these two types of lyophilizers will depend on factors such as the volume of material to be processed, the required drying time, and the budget available for the purchase.
In addition to the upfront cost of a lyophilizer, it is essential to consider the long-term operating costs associated with the machine. This includes maintenance, energy consumption, and the cost of consumables such as vacuum pump oil and desiccant. Some lyophilizers are more energy-efficient than others and may have lower operating costs over time, offsetting their higher initial price. It is crucial to compare not only the purchase price of different lyophilizers but also their total cost of ownership to make an informed decision.
